Qi Wuhuo was listening attentively. He subconsciously walked forward and took a few more steps to avoid the rocks. The full moon was hanging high in the sky, and the moonlight was flowing down like water. His vision suddenly opened up and the person reciting the poem came into his sight.
Under the full moon, on the blue stone, an old man in a purple robe was sitting cross-legged. He had white hair and beard, but he looked very energetic. There was a gourd hanging around his waist. With a smile on his lips, he was extending his hand to wave him over.
As winter night approached, I met an old man in the mountains.
It could be a passerby who had lost his way, but it could also be a demon in disguise. Qi Wuhuo pursed his lips, held the place where he was carrying the backpack with his left hand, and pressed his right hand down to his waist, where there was a small dagger that was sharpened.
He was young but never bullied by the hooligans in the town. It was impossible that he just relied on the knowledge from books.
He took a few steps forward and said, "It's getting late. Winter is coming soon. It's especially cold in the mountains. It's almost freezing to death at midnight. Why are you still staying here, old man?"
Naturally, the boy's actions could not be hidden from the many "immortal students" around him.
The many birds, beasts, and monsters hiding nearby were almost terrified when they saw this. The old man in front of them must be a man of status and magical powers. He came here and cast an extremely mysterious spell, which attracted many monsters to preach. Although the monsters did not know his identity, they were all very respectful.
I don't know how this young man got in here and he's so courageous.
Next to him was a white-browed tiger with its claws covering its mouth, its eyes wide open like a big cat in the world. Even a newborn calf was not afraid of a tiger, so this young child was actually not afraid of anything? !
The old man didn't think anything of it. He just stroked his beard, then smiled and pointed at his legs, saying:
"My family lives in the west of the capital. I came here to visit my relatives and friends. I saw that the scenery of this mountain was very beautiful, so I went up the mountain to enjoy it. Unknowingly, I missed the time. When I was in a hurry to go down the mountain, I took a wrong step and broke my leg."
"There's no one in front of me and no road behind me. I can only sit here for a while and make some noise, hoping that there are still woodcutters and mountaineers who haven't come down the mountain yet and can lead them over to help me."
"Otherwise, with the heavy snow blocking the mountain today, I'm afraid I'll die on the mountain and be eaten by wild beasts."
This joke made all the monsters on the mountain shudder. Qi Wuhuo took a look and saw that the old man's legs and feet were indeed abnormal under the moonlight. He let down his guard a little, walked forward and checked the wound. He indeed felt flesh and blood, and it was undoubtedly a human.
Seeing that it was an elderly man, most of his hesitation disappeared. He half-knelt and asked the old man to stretch out his injured leg. He pressed on it and checked it. He breathed a sigh of relief and said, "It's not bad. No bones or muscles are injured. Apply some medicine to the wound and rest. It will recover in about a month."
He first straightened the old man's bones, then took out some dry food and water in a bamboo tube for the old man to drink to fill his stomach. The old man smiled and said, "Young brother, do you know any medical skills?"
Qi Wuhuo helped to bind the injured leg with a strip of cloth and said without looking up:
"Five years ago, when I was fleeing from a disaster, I traveled with a gentleman for a while and he taught me a few things."
The old man looked slightly strange and asked, "So he is your teacher?"
"Where is he now?"
Qi Wuhuo paused and replied:
"When I was passing through Bingzhou, I accidentally fell into the demon country. There were hundreds of thousands of displaced people at the time. The demon ghosts were doing business at the roadside [vegetable market], using people as vegetables. To pass the demon country checkpoint, they had to pay 100 kilograms of 'vegetable meat'. He walked into the vegetable market himself, and it was my turn to get out."
"He said: The young ones will live."
The old man looked more ashamed, and suddenly he felt his legs tighten. It turned out that Qi Wuhuo had tied up his injured leg. Then the young man breathed a sigh of relief, raised his head and smiled, "In this case, your leg is fine. But it's getting late, and there may be heavy snow in the next few days."
"When the snow melts, the mountains are extremely cold. Even blind bears will find a place to lie down and sleep. If you don't mind, you can stay at my house for a while until your injury heals. Or I can carry you to the town at the foot of the mountain. Although the town is remote, there is an inn where you can stay."
The old man stroked his beard and smiled, "I feel very compatible with little brother."
"If you don't think I'm bothering you, I'd really like to spend more time with you."
So Qi Wuhuo tied a rope around the backpack, hung it around his neck, placed it in front of himself, squatted down slightly, let the old man lie on his back, and then stood up.
He often went in and out of the mountains and forests, chopping wood and carrying firewood. He was actually in good physical condition, and carrying an old man on his back was not a big deal, as he still walked very fast.
The night fog from before was still thick, but now Qi Wuhuo could see it.
The old man lowered his eyes slightly, intending to test his character, so he did not let the fog dissipate, but made it even deeper, making the mountain road seem steep, and his own weight gradually increased.
When Qi Wuhuo took ten steps, he was still just an ordinary old man.
After taking twenty steps, he feels like a thirty-year-old man.
After walking more than a hundred steps, it was almost like carrying a stone statue on his back. Qi Wuhuo's strength had just reached its limit. He was extremely tired but could still hold on. His pace gradually slowed down, but he never stopped.
The night finally deepened.
As winter approaches, the wild beasts in the mountains are starving. They have to store enough fat to survive the cold winter. The sky is dark blue, the trees are silhouetted, and the howling of wolves can be heard, as if they are approaching.
If it were an ordinary person, most of them would have been trembling with fear.
Qi Wuhuo's breathing was a little disordered, but his steps were still steady. He just lowered his right hand to hold the dagger at his waist. Apart from that, the young man's sweat-soaked clothes and the heat on his neck proved that he was indeed extremely physically exhausted.
The old man nodded in approval.
Suddenly Qi Wuhuo whispered, "Old sir, I held down the dagger just now when we first met, and then invited you to come down the mountain. It was a bit presumptuous. I hope you don't mind it. I smelled the scent of a monster, so I was worried."
The old man seemed surprised: "Monster?"
Qi Wuhuo said: "Yes."
The old man asked, "Can you smell the monster?"
Qi Wuhuo paused, and then replied:
"If you see a lot of monsters, you'll be able to smell them a little bit."
The old man was speechless. Considering the previous demon country and the disaster, he knew that this was definitely not a memory that ordinary people would be willing to come into contact with.
Suddenly I felt that testing my character in this way was boring.
Isn’t the character of this young man as clear as the bright moon?
He sighed secretly and simply dissipated the spell.
Qi Wuhuo did not notice that the weight of the old man behind him suddenly weakened.
There was also a mysterious feeling surging into his body, healed the many hidden injuries left by the disaster. Qi Wuhuo only felt that his meridians were instantly relaxed, yang energy was generated in the soles of his feet, and the lost physical strength was restored in an instant. When he looked up again, the night fog had dissipated, and lights could be seen faintly in the road ahead.
Qi Wuhuo couldn't help but breathe a sigh of relief and said happily:
"Father, we've arrived at my town."
After saying this, he walked down the mountain with the old man on his back.
The moonlight in the sky was bright and clear, and the young man walked with big strides. Walking in the mountains at night is a very dangerous thing, but in places invisible to the naked eye, there is a group of goblins and monsters protecting them, driving away the evil spirits silently, like a ceremonial guard, with a solemn and awe-inspiring manner, a fox holding a candle in front, and a tiger pressing its claws behind.
The hungry wolves and wild beasts did not dare to come over, and the wandering ghosts and spirits gathered in the mountains with evil spirits did not dare to bully them.
There was a mountain god in this place who was wandering at night, free and easy. He saw a group of monsters walking around at night from afar and was dumbfounded. He retreated more than a hundred miles in horror. When he looked back, he was still in the area shrouded by fog. He could not see the way forward or the way back. He was extremely frightened, fearing that some demon, great sage or immortal from land was on patrol, so he hurriedly burned incense to inform the gods.
Qi Wuhuo walked down the mountain and the old man looked back.
The night fog that covered the mountains and rivers for hundreds of miles suddenly dissipated. The fog became smaller and smaller, and in the end, it was just a piece of purple gauze on the hat.
In addition, the mountains and rivers are clear, the wind is gentle and the moon is bright.
